How to Use a Variable Life Insurance Calculator Effectively

A variable life insurance calculator is a planning tool that helps you estimate how a permanent life insurance policy may perform over time. Unlike term insurance, which provides coverage for a set period, variable life insurance combines lifelong coverage with an investment component. Part of your premium funds the insurance charges, while another part may be allocated to investment subaccounts. The cash value can grow, decline, or remain flat depending on market performance, expenses, mortality charges, and the premium schedule you choose. Because so many variables affect outcomes, a calculator can help you test assumptions before committing to a policy design.

The calculator above focuses on the inputs most consumers and advisors review first: age, annual premium, face amount, assumed return, annual policy charges, rider costs, and death benefit option. By changing only one or two factors at a time, you can better understand how sensitive long range projections are to investment performance and ongoing costs. That matters because variable life insurance is not simply a savings account inside a life policy. It is a securities based product, and the value of the investments can fluctuate. If investment returns are weak or charges rise as you age, a policy that looked healthy in one illustration can become underfunded later on.

Most real policies are more complex. Actual products may include premium loads, monthly deductions, surrender charges, subaccount expense ratios, no lapse guarantees, partial withdrawals, loans, corridor rules, and different death benefit options. Even so, a calculator is useful because it turns abstract policy mechanics into understandable numbers. If your estimated cash value is thin or flat despite years of premium payments, that may be a sign to review funding, charges, or policy structure more carefully with a professional.

Why Variable Life Insurance Is Different From Other Policy Types

Many consumers confuse variable life insurance with whole life or universal life. Whole life policies generally offer fixed guarantees and a more stable, insurer managed cash value schedule. Universal life policies are more flexible on premiums and death benefits, but many versions still use a declared interest rate or index linked crediting method rather than direct subaccount investment exposure. Variable life insurance, by contrast, places investment risk and reward much more directly on the policyowner. That can create stronger upside in favorable markets, but it also introduces downside risk.

Policy Type Cash Value Growth Driver Typical Risk Level Premium Flexibility Best Fit
Whole Life Guaranteed values plus possible dividends Lower Usually fixed People seeking predictability and conservative planning
Universal Life Declared interest or policy specific crediting method Moderate Flexible People who want adjustable funding and death benefit choices
Variable Life Investment subaccount performance Higher Often less flexible than variable universal life, but policy dependent People comfortable with market risk and long time horizons

The key takeaway is simple: a variable life insurance calculator should never be used as a guaranteed forecast. It is best viewed as a scenario testing tool. Consider running conservative, moderate, and optimistic assumptions. For example, instead of only modeling a 7 percent return, also test 4 percent and 2 percent return scenarios. If the policy only looks sustainable under aggressive assumptions, that is a warning sign.

Inputs That Matter Most in a Variable Life Insurance Projection

While every field in the calculator plays a role, several inputs tend to have an outsized impact on policy performance:

  1. Age at issue. Insurance charges are usually lower at younger ages. Buying earlier can improve long term efficiency.
  2. Annual premium. The premium determines how much money is available to cover charges and build cash value.
  3. Investment return assumption. Small changes in return assumptions can produce large differences over 20 to 30 years.
  4. Fee drag. Ongoing policy and investment expenses reduce compounding. Even a 1 percent fee difference matters over time.
  5. Death benefit option. A level option may allow cash value to offset more of the amount at risk over time, while an increasing option keeps more insurance exposure in place.

If you are comparing two possible policies, use the same return assumption in both examples. This allows you to isolate differences in charges, death benefit structure, and funding design. Also pay attention to whether your planned premium appears comfortably above the minimum needed to support the policy. Underfunding is one of the most common reasons permanent insurance performs worse than expected.

How to Interpret the Results

After running the calculator, focus on four outputs. First, review the projected cash value. This gives you an estimate of what may remain in the policy after funding, charges, and assumed returns. Second, look at the projected death benefit. Under a level option, the death benefit may stay closer to the base face amount, while under an increasing option it may rise with accumulated cash value. Third, compare total premiums paid against total estimated policy charges. If charges consume too much of the premium over time, the policy may need adjustment. Fourth, review whether the calculator flags any lapse risk or weak funding indicators.

Many people focus only on the largest projected value at the end of the illustration. That is not the best way to evaluate a permanent policy. A healthier approach is to ask:

  • Does the policy still look sustainable under lower return assumptions?
  • Is the premium level realistic for my budget over many years?
  • Would I still want the death benefit if market returns are disappointing?
  • How do the costs compare with term insurance plus separate investing?
  • What happens if I stop premiums early or need access to cash?

Variable Life Insurance Pros and Cons

Variable life insurance can be powerful in the right situation, but it is not universally appropriate. Understanding the tradeoffs is essential before relying on any calculator output.

  • Potential advantages: lifelong coverage, tax deferred cash value growth, investment upside, and possible estate or legacy planning benefits.
  • Potential drawbacks: market risk, policy complexity, fees, higher funding needs, and the possibility of lapse if performance is weak and premiums are insufficient.

This means the calculator should be used alongside broader financial planning. If your emergency fund is thin, high interest debt is large, or retirement accounts are not yet well funded, it may make sense to solve those priorities first. On the other hand, high earners, business owners, and households with long term estate or protection needs may find variable life insurance worth considering in a diversified plan.

Best Practices for Running Better Scenarios

  1. Run at least three return cases: conservative, base, and optimistic.
  2. Test different premium levels to see the minimum funding needed for a stable policy trajectory.
  3. Compare level and increasing death benefit options.
  4. Recalculate using higher fee assumptions if you are unsure about expenses.
  5. Review projections annually because age based insurance charges often rise over time.

For example, suppose a 35 year old is considering a $250,000 variable life policy with a $6,000 annual premium. At a strong return assumption, the policy may show substantial cash value by year 30. But if you lower expected returns by 2 percentage points and increase annual costs slightly, the same policy may finish with a much thinner cushion. That is not a flaw in the calculator. It is a realistic demonstration of how sensitive market linked permanent insurance can be.
